Whose Poland Will It Be? - Asked Jan Olszewski

Summary by wpolityce.pl
Thirty-six years have passed since 1989, which is much longer than the entire Second Polish Republic, to which we so often refer, proudly recalling those achievements in every field, and yet Poland was then rebuilding itself from scratch after 123 years of partitions and fighting a great, victorious battle against the Bolsheviks, defending the entire Western civilization.
